Job Description Responsibilities Registered Nurse - PCU -
Full-time Nights 7pm - 7am Sign-On Bonus, Eligible Aiken Regional
Medical Centers, located in Aiken, South Carolina, is a 273-bed
acute care facility providing top quality and safe healthcare to
the residents of Aiken and surrounding communities since 1917.
Aiken Regional Medical Centers has been ranked a top hospital in
South Carolina by the American Heart Association for its treatment
of heart attack, heart failure and Stroke, and most recently,
coronary artery disease. Additionally, Aiken Regional provides
comprehensive healthcare services such as behavioral health (
Aurora Pavilion Behavioral Health ), emergency medical care (main
hospital and ER at Sweetwater ), orthopedic surgeries, maternity,
rehabilitation services ( Hitchcock Rehabilitation Services ),
imaging, and wound care. Visit us online at:

Benefits Guest Website: uhsguest.co About Universal Health Services
One of the nation’s largest and most respected providers of
hospital and healthcare services, Universal Health Services, Inc.
(NYSE: UHS) has built an impressive record of achievement and
performance, growing since its inception into a Fortune 500
corporation. Headquartered in King of Prussia, PA, UHS has 99,000
employees. Through its subsidiaries, UHS operates 28 acute care
hospitals, 331 behavioral health facilities, 60 outpatient and
other facilities in 39 U.S. States, Washington, D.C., Puerto Rico
